I have revisited this. I unplugged my masterbedroom node, and sure enough it still showed up as the master bedroom even though i was attached to the bathroom node. I looked and there was another device (unifi) that was attached based on the mac address to the same ha "device" that one had an area attached to it. So I think the issue I ran into was this related to this. I have removed the areas and readding them and readding my esphome device. Will report back shortly. |
|
Ok. I can confirm that seems to be the case. Either bermuda was holding on to an area (unlikely) or it's possible if you have another integration that uses something like network mac addresses to add more entities a device, that integration device could have an area assigned. I removed my device from unifi integration and esphome and re-added to both and it's all working now. |

I am guessing it's something with my ESP32 esphome bt proxy, but I have a BT proxy in my master bathroom. When I am in there it shows i am in the master bedroom. I enabled the "nearest scanner" entity and oddly enough it said that the nearest scanner was the master bathroom, but the "area" entity for my device still showed the master bedroom. Not sure what I did or how to test / correct. Any thoughts?
